3 SUSPECTS FROM MICHIGAN ARRESTED AFTER SMASH & GRAB – PEORIA, IL

On 2/26/21, at approximately 12:15 p.m., two male subjects entered a mall and smashed a jewelry store’s glass cases with a sledgehammer. They then entered an awaiting vehicle and drove off. No one was injured during the robbery. Police were provided with a description of the vehicle. They determined the subjects were traveling on interstate 74. The suspects’ vehicle was stopped, two of the subjects then fled on foot into a wooded area, the third subject remained in the vehicle. All three suspects were arrested. They were identified as 19-year-old Terrion G. Johnson, 21-year-old Jabreez L. Thompkins, and 26-year-old Christopher K. Smith. All three suspects are residents of Michigan.
